ResponsibilitiesA Day in the Life…
- Assist in the planning, coordination, and execution of projects
- Field data collection and testing, evaluation and development of technical solutions for MEP systems
- Collaboration with fellow engineers, technicians, managers, sub-contractors and crafts personnel
- Condition assessment and preparation of single lines for electrical and HVAC
- Support the making of databases for proper CMMS (Computerized Maintenance Management System) programs
